Match Preview
The rampageous Red Devils announced their presence on the world stage by bagging three goals in their opening group game against Panama. Having endured a dull first 45 minutes, a Dries Mertens' second-half volley and Romelu Lukaku's double secured all three points for Roberto Martinez's men.
A tricky test, however, awaits them coming up against a wounded Tunisian side. The North Africans nearly shared spoils with England in their opening group encounter but for Harry Kane's match-winning goal in stoppage time.
As such, any result other than a win or draw could bring the Carthage Eagle's World Cup campaign to an abrupt end. Coming up against a Belgian side that has a 20-game unbeaten run under its belt, Nabil Maaloul's men will be required to use every trick in their book to halt the progress of the domineering Europeans.
Following the defeat to the Three Lions, Tunisia's winless run at the Word was extended to 12 and the Africans are yet to win a game in four appearances across all competitions. Their feat has mainly been down to a poor defense and with Belgium boasting one of the best attacking fronts at this year's World Cup, a goal feat may as well be on the card.
Saturday's meeting will be the fourth between the two nations. Both Tunisia and Belgium have a win, a draw and a defeat apiece in the three previous matches.
